Who wrote My Whole Life lyrics?


My Whole Life is written by Stephen Garrett, Dominick Lamb, Anderson Sunshine, Curtis Lee Mayfield.
✔️

When was My Whole Life released?


It is first released on June 20, 2005 as part of Left Alone's album "Lonely Starts and Broken Hearts" which includes 13 tracks in total. This song is the 5th track on this album.
✔️

Which genre is My Whole Life?


My Whole Life falls under the genre Rock.
✔️

How long is the song My Whole Life?


My Whole Life song length is 2 minutes and 11 seconds.
